European Ambitions and Strategic Rivalries

The historical prestige of Austria Wien, one of the most decorated clubs in Austrian football, contrasts sharply with the passionate, high-pressure environment surrounding Beitar Jerusalem. When these two sides face potential crossover in qualifying rounds, the dynamic is defined by a clash of footballing philosophies. Austria Wien typically emphasizes technical fluidity and a disciplined approach derived from a robust youth development pipeline, while Beitar Jerusalem relies on intense vertical transitions and the fervent backing of a loyal fanbase that often influences the tempo of home matches.

For Austria Wien, the 2026 campaign is about reclaiming consistency on the European stage. The current coaching staff has prioritized tactical flexibility, ensuring the squad can shift between a compact defensive block and an aggressive high press depending on the opposition. Conversely, Beitar Jerusalem’s 2026 strategy centers on overcoming early-season fatigue. As both leagues manage the physical toll of summer qualifying rounds, the ability to rotate key personnel without sacrificing cohesion remains the primary barrier to securing a lucrative group-stage berth.

Broadcast Access and Matchday Logistics

Securing reliable access to high-stakes qualifiers is a priority for international supporters in 2026. Given the current broadcasting landscape, these fixtures are generally distributed through regional sports networks and specialized streaming platforms that hold UEFA qualifying rights. Fans based in Austria can typically access coverage via public broadcasters or premium sports channels, whereas those following Beitar Jerusalem often utilize official league streaming services or international rights holders.

Ticket procurement for these high-demand fixtures generally opens in phases. Austria Wien utilizes a priority system for members and season ticket holders before releasing individual match seats, while Beitar Jerusalem’s ticketing processes often move rapidly due to the high volume of demand for matches at Teddy Stadium. Supporters traveling for away fixtures are encouraged to monitor official club channels for dedicated fan zone information and security protocols, as regulations for international football travel in Europe and the Middle East remain strict throughout the 2026 season.
